💬 Notre avis

Serverlesscode est un site qui propose des ressources et des guides pour aider les développeurs à comprendre et à utiliser les architectures sans serveur. C'est un bon point de départ si tu es novice et que tu souhaites apprendre à déployer des applications cloud sans avoir à gérer des serveurs. Toutefois, le site est un peu moins connu que d'autres ressources comme AWS ou Azure, qui offrent des documentations et des tutoriels beaucoup plus complets. Si tu cherches des informations approfondies, tu pourrais te sentir un peu limité ici. En plus, certaines sections semblent manquer de mises à jour, ce qui peut te laisser dans le flou sur les dernières technologies. Il n'y a pas de frais cachés, mais attention, la plupart des services que tu pourrais trouver ici peuvent engendrer des coûts selon ton utilisation chez les fournisseurs de cloud. En gros, si tu cherches à te lancer dans le sans serveur, cela peut valoir le coup, mais n'hésite pas à comparer avec des alternatives comme Serverless.com ou même des forums plus établis comme Stack Overflow. <!-- ai-reviewed -->

Project Honey Pot

Project Honey Pot

Project Honey Pot is the first and only distributed system for identifying spammers and the spambots they use to scrape addresses from your website. Using the Project Honey Pot system you can install addresses that are custom-tagged to the time and IP address of a visitor to your site. If one of these addresses begins receiving email we not only can tell that the messages are spam, but also the exact moment when the address was harvested and the IP address that gathered it.

sqlmap

sqlmap

sqlmap is an open source penetration testing tool that automates the process of detecting and exploiting SQL injection flaws and taking over of database servers. It comes with a powerful detection engine, many niche features for the ultimate penetration tester and a broad range of switches lasting from database fingerprinting, over data fetching from the database, to accessing the underlying file system and executing commands on the operating system via out-of-band connections.
